Key Features of Cyrille
Cyrille stands out due to its rich set of features that enhance its usability and visual appeal. One of its most notable characteristics is its PUA (Private Use Area) encoding, which allows users to easily access all the cute glyphs and swashes without the need for additional software. This feature makes it simple to customize text and create unique typographic effects.
Another advantage of Cyrille is its extensive range of special features, including alternate glyphs and ligatures. These elements provide designers with greater flexibility when crafting text, enabling them to achieve a more dynamic and visually engaging result. Whether you're creating a wedding invitation or a brand logo, these features allow for creative expression without compromising on professionalism.

Tips for Using Cyrille Effectively
To get the most out of Cyrille, consider the following tips:
- Experiment with spacing: Adjusting letter spacing can significantly impact how Cyrille appears. Try increasing or decreasing spacing to find the optimal balance between readability and visual appeal.
- Use alternates wisely: While Cyrille offers a wealth of alternate glyphs, it's important not to overuse them. Selecting a few key alternates can add character without overwhelming the reader.
- Pair with complementary fonts: Combining Cyrille with a simpler, sans-serif font can create a harmonious contrast. This technique is especially effective for headings and subheadings.
- Test on different mediums: Ensure that Cyrille looks good across various platforms, including print, web, and mobile devices. Make adjustments as needed to maintain consistency.
